remove rear speakers
 
Merry Christmas to all - A newbie here so I may be posting incorrectly. I want to replace the lame speakers that came with my 2007 F150 Super Crew but am unsure as to how to remove the door panels to get to the speakers that are in the rear doors. Help please!!

LovetheTide 12-25-2008 04:49 PM

I've replaced mine but I still had to look this up since last time I just did it more by feel.

This is for a Scab but it's the same.
1.Pry off the two separate upper pieces on each side of the window. The smaller one is held on by two clips in rectangular holes in the door. Just pull until you can get a couple fingers under it give a good yank. Check to make sure the clips are fully seated on the back of the panel so it will be tight when you put it back on. The other larger piece is held with 5 clips (one that stays on the door). I put a glove on to get my fingers in the hole for the door latch and pulled. It is difficult but will come off. Again double check the clips.

2.Pry off the panel that holds the window switch. You should be able to push it up with your fingers. It is just snapped in. Unplug the switch (a small tab on on side holds it, press it with a screwdriver to ease it off without breaking the tab). Set the switch aside. Take out the bolt that is behind the switch.

3.Snap off the small rectangular panel (about 3/4in by 3in long)behing the door handle. A small flat srcewdriver will help. This exposes two brass bolts. Remove them and take off the handle and surrounding bracket. When reinstalling this make sure the handle is straight when easing it in place or it wont pull the latches.

4.Remove the 3 small gray bolts form the edge of the door panel. Two are at the top ( they are exposed from where the two upper panels were). One is roughly in the center of the bottom.

5. Gently lift up the entire panel and it will slide the snap in retainers out of the door and it is off. The speaker is wide open to be snatched out. (To reinstall the panel just position it about 2 inches high in alignment with everything and push back down. Make sure to press in on the center so the clips will catch in the holes in the door).

6.Put in the new speaker and follow the steps in reverse to reattach all of the pieces. Just take care that everything is seated properly and take your time.
